Why did AI Scoring select the Default Answer or return an error even though the transcript contains the evidence needed to answer the question?

AI Scoring performs an exact text match between the model’s response and the answer options configured in the evaluation form. If accents or special characters are used inconsistently across the question, help text, and answer options—for example, “Sí” in one place and “Si” in another—the system may not recognize a valid match.

When this occurs, AI Scoring may select the Default Answer or return a low-confidence error, even when the transcript contains the evidence needed to answer the question.

To avoid this issue, use accents and special characters consistently throughout the evaluation form.
